    Ichigo was supposed to be in the European/UK case 994B back in July, but quite clearly not enough of her were produced, so an extra Shuey was put into her place in the 2,000 UK cases. The few Ichigo's there were left over were supposedly sold through Disney Stores in the UK. Of the three Chase cars in 2013 so far, only Miles Axlerod has had general release! I had been told by two DS staff that a few Ichigo's did appear in late July. Mattel can at least tick that box! I don't recall seeing any on eBay UK, so quite how many there were is anyone's guess. That said, some could easily make their way into Tesco clipstrip assortments! We got our Francesca via that route! Another box ticked, Mattel UK! Whilst many collectors miss out (again)! Hmmm!

    The last case 998E effectively took the place of the cancelled 998D case, so Mattel could easily have made some amends and *treated* us to 2,000 Ruka's and 4,000 Mildred's. OK, they have got nearly all the standard singles out, but no Deluxe, no Doubles and far too few Chase cars (except Miles).

              By any measure 2012 was a disaster. This year was much better, but could've been a vintage year had it not been for Mattel UK dumping loads of the rest of the worlds rejects and overstocks upon us! Even without the 996Y case, they could've given us a full compliment of 2013 singles cases on general circulation. They could easily have let DS have all four Chase car cases on a first-to-market basis; everyone's a winner and happy!

              When you consider the much smaller markets across Europe, they had all the Deluxe and Doubles, nearly all TRU RS Classics and Cars Take Flight! Not releasing any of those individually is unforgiveable, but collectively that's an awful lot of mistakes!
